Abstract
A catalyst for reducing nitrogen oxides, carbon monoxide and hydrocarbons, the noxious components in exhaust gases from internal combustion engines, etc., comprising: a porous carrier consisting essentially of zirconia and at least one oxide selected from the group consisting of cerium oxide, manganese oxide and iron oxide; and a metal as a catalyst ingredient supported thereon selected from the group consisting of platinum, palladium and mixtures thereof. A method for producing the aforesaid catalyst.
